What are the opposite words for un-surenesses?

The term "un-surenesses" refers to a lack of confidence or certainty about something. Its antonyms include confidence, assurance, certainty, conviction, and trust. Confidence refers to a belief in one's ability or knowledge. Assurance implies a sense of trust and assurance in something. Certainty refers to a firm and unwavering belief or knowledge. Conviction refers to a strong belief or opinion about something. Trust implies a belief in the reliability of something or someone. Therefore, when one experiences "un-surenesses," they can combat it by fostering confidence, assurance, certainty, conviction, and trust in themselves or others.
